void V8XMLHttpRequest::openMethodCustom(const v8::FunctionCallbackInfo<v8::Value>& info)
{
    // Four cases:
    // open(method, url)
    // open(method, url, async)
    // open(method, url, async, user)
    // open(method, url, async, user, passwd)

    ExceptionState exceptionState(ExceptionState::ExecutionContext, "open", "XMLHttpRequest", info.Holder(), info.GetIsolate());

    if (info.Length() < 2) {
        exceptionState.throwTypeError(ExceptionMessages::notEnoughArguments(2, info.Length()));
        exceptionState.throwIfNeeded();
        return;
    }

    XMLHttpRequest* xmlHttpRequest = V8XMLHttpRequest::toNative(info.Holder());

    TOSTRING_VOID(V8StringResource<>, method, info[0]);
    TOSTRING_VOID(V8StringResource<>, urlstring, info[1]);

    ExecutionContext* context = currentExecutionContext(info.GetIsolate());
    KURL url = context->completeURL(urlstring);

    if (info.Length() >= 3) {
        bool async = info[2]->BooleanValue();

        if (info.Length() >= 4 && !info[3]->IsUndefined()) {
            TOSTRING_VOID(V8StringResource<TreatNullAsNullString>, user, info[3]);

            if (info.Length() >= 5 && !info[4]->IsUndefined()) {
                TOSTRING_VOID(V8StringResource<TreatNullAsNullString>, password, info[4]);
                xmlHttpRequest->open(method, url, async, user, password, exceptionState);
            } else {
                xmlHttpRequest->open(method, url, async, user, exceptionState);
            }
        } else {
            xmlHttpRequest->open(method, url, async, exceptionState);
        }
    } else {
        xmlHttpRequest->open(method, url, exceptionState);
    }

    exceptionState.throwIfNeeded();
}

void V8XMLHttpRequest::responseAttributeGetterCustom(
    const v8::FunctionCallbackInfo<v8::Value>& info) {
  XMLHttpRequest* xmlHttpRequest = V8XMLHttpRequest::toImpl(info.Holder());
  ExceptionState exceptionState(info.GetIsolate(),
                                ExceptionState::GetterContext, "XMLHttpRequest",
                                "response");

  switch (xmlHttpRequest->getResponseTypeCode()) {
    case XMLHttpRequest::ResponseTypeDefault:
    case XMLHttpRequest::ResponseTypeText:
      responseTextAttributeGetterCustom(info);
      return;

    case XMLHttpRequest::ResponseTypeJSON: {
      v8::Isolate* isolate = info.GetIsolate();

      ScriptString jsonSource = xmlHttpRequest->responseJSONSource();
      if (jsonSource.isEmpty()) {
        v8SetReturnValue(info, v8::Null(isolate));
        return;
      }

      // Catch syntax error. Swallows an exception (when thrown) as the
      // spec says. https://xhr.spec.whatwg.org/#response-body
      v8::Local<v8::Value> json = fromJSONString(
          isolate, toCoreString(jsonSource.v8Value()), exceptionState);
      if (exceptionState.hadException()) {
        exceptionState.clearException();
        v8SetReturnValue(info, v8::Null(isolate));
      } else {
        v8SetReturnValue(info, json);
      }
      return;
    }

    case XMLHttpRequest::ResponseTypeDocument: {
      Document* document = xmlHttpRequest->responseXML(exceptionState);
      v8SetReturnValueFast(info, document, xmlHttpRequest);
      return;
    }

    case XMLHttpRequest::ResponseTypeBlob: {
      Blob* blob = xmlHttpRequest->responseBlob();
      v8SetReturnValueFast(info, blob, xmlHttpRequest);
      return;
    }

    case XMLHttpRequest::ResponseTypeArrayBuffer: {
      DOMArrayBuffer* arrayBuffer = xmlHttpRequest->responseArrayBuffer();
      v8SetReturnValueFast(info, arrayBuffer, xmlHttpRequest);
      return;
    }
  }
}
